About Red Tractor
Assured Food Standards (AFS), home of the Red Tractor scheme, unites the entire supply chain - from farmers and processors to retailers and foodservice - under a single, world-leading assurance marque. Our standards are internationally recognised, and our logo is a symbol of confidence for millions of consumers. We are committed to modernising our approach, deepening engagement with stakeholders, and ensuring Red Tractor remains the assurance scheme of choice in a rapidly changing sector.
